What Will You Learn?

Art and Design Level 2 Diploma (Bracknell) introduces learners to key creative concepts and practical techniques while supporting the development of individual artistic expression. Students will explore different methods of creating and presenting artwork while gaining an understanding of the design process.

Learners may develop skills and knowledge in areas including:

  • Exploring different art and design materials, techniques, and processes.
  • Developing creative ideas through research and experimentation.
  • Understanding how artists and designers respond to briefs.
  • Creating both two-dimensional and three-dimensional work.
  • Improving drawing, visual communication, and practical making skills.
  • Learning how to review, reflect on, and evaluate creative outcomes.
  • Building confidence in presenting ideas and developing a personal creative style.

The course combines practical activities with research and evaluation, helping learners understand how creative professionals develop concepts from initial ideas through to completed work. Students are encouraged to experiment with different approaches and discover areas of art and design that match their interests.
